Walk into any bar and you'll notice a variety of glasses in all shapes and sizes shining back at you. Why is a martini served in elegant stemware while a whisky arrives in a short, portly snifter? Is this simply about appearance or does the glass impact the beverage's taste?

NYC bar owner Matt Piacentini pours most drinks in five types of glasses; Tales of the Cocktail's American Bartender of the Year Joaquín Simó believes you only need three: "You can make 90 percent of drinks in a rocks, a collins, and a good all-purpose cocktail glass" (via New York Magazine). Yet Home Stratosphere lists 27 different cocktail glasses; and martini glasses alone come in different shapes, from the Nick and Nora to a coupe (per Liquor). Real Simple recommends shelves should be stocked with at least 10 different varieties, and Men's Journal cuts the list down to four (the coupe, rocks, collins, and decanter). The recommendations are enough to overwhelm any aspiring mixologist. So how many types of glasses do you need for an at-home setup &#; and why does it matter?

About Terrile Massimilanio

Terrile Massimilanio is a Head Bartender at Duck and Waffle, London, UK. Terrile has more than ten years of experience in the hospitality business. He has worked with various restaurants and bars including 21 The Print Room cocktail bar (Covent Garden), Smith's of Smithfield cocktail bar (Barbican), Avalon club (Piccadilly), Giraffe (Soho) and Portofino Kauai.
